The Australian Silky Terrier is a small and compact short-legged terrier, 23 to 26 cm (9.1 to 10.2 in) at the withers, alert and active. The long silky grey and white or blue and tan coat is an identifying feature, hanging straight and parted along the back, and described as "flat, fine and glossy". [1]

The breed made its way to America via servicemen stationed in Australia during and after World War II. The U.S. adopted the name, Silky Terrier and the AKC recognized the breed in 1959 and placed in the Toy Group. Although very popular when first introduced, the Silky Terrier is ranked 98th today by the American Kennel Club.

The Australian Silky Terrier is a strong, healthy breed with few health problems. It can live for up to 15 years or more. Like most breeds, it may develop arthritis or cataracts in old age, but will otherwise live a long, healthy life if it is properly cared for. Weight — 8-10 pounds. Coat length & texture — Long, straight, silky, and glossy. Coat color — All shades of blue and tan. The deep tan color should extend from the base of the skull to the tail tip and halfway down the legs. Silky terrier puppies are born black and tan but the black fades to blue as they mature.

Size: This dog is around 10 inches tall and can weigh around 10 pounds. Head: The Silky has a wedge-shaped head with small, almond-shaped eyes. The fur on their head is nicely parted down the middle. Coat: The most distinctive feature of the Silky Terrier is their long, silky coat that hags straight down. Their coat color is blue and tan.
